Sudan: Prevalence of anemia among pregnant women (%)

In , Sudan's Prevalence of anemia among pregnant women (%) was 38.00.

That's up 1.3% from 2022, the highest value since .

The global average for this indicator in 2023 was 30.41 . Sudan ranks #45 globally out of 192 reporting countries. Within Sub-Saharan Africa, it ranks #35 of 48.

Source: World Bank Open Data (SH.PRG.ANEM) • Data as of 2023

About Prevalence of anemia among pregnant women (%)

Prevalence of anemia, pregnant women, is the percentage of pregnant women whose hemoglobin level is less than 110 grams per liter at sea level.
